CAPC Palliative Care Program Spotlight

Retaining and Training Staff with Providence St. Peter Hospital

01 Mar 2017

Description

This podcast features a conversation with Gregg VandeKieft, MD, MA, Medical Director for Palliative Care at Providence St. Peter Hospital, a Magnet Hospital in Washington. Palliative Care at Providence St. Peter Hospital is doing well. The program has done a great job engaging primary care clinicians to increase referrals, their institution has bought into their model, and they are staffed with a full time group committed to the cause. But with success comes growing pains and new obstacles. A recent study showed that the majority of hospitals offering palliative care services fail to meet national staffing guidelines. The study looked at over 400 palliative care programs and found that only 25 percent have all recommended staff positions filled full-time. In this conversation with Doctor VandeKieft—whose team does meet the national standard—we discuss his philosophy on training and retaining a robust team of fill time staff to meet their growing need. We also discuss the evolution of palliative care in the last fifteen years and a host of other topics.
